Why this is a more solid answer:
The solid answer expands on the basic answer by providing specific details about the candidate's role as the lead programmer and their responsibilities in implementing the gameplay mechanics and optimizing performance. It also addresses the evaluation areas from the job description by mentioning programming skills, game design principles, time management, and effective communication. However, it can be further improved by incorporating more details about the candidate's problem-solving skills and collaboration with the team.

How to prepare for this question
- Reflect on your past game projects and identify the one you are most proud of. Consider the role you played, the challenges you faced, and the impact your work had on the final product.
- Prepare specific examples of the programming tasks you performed in the game project, such as implementing game mechanics, optimizing performance, or integrating external libraries.
- Highlight your problem-solving skills by discussing any challenges you encountered during the project and how you overcame them. This could include debugging complex issues or finding creative solutions to design problems.
- Discuss your collaboration with the team, emphasizing effective communication and the ability to work in a team environment. Mention any instances where you actively contributed to the design or visual aspects of the game.
- Be prepared to provide metrics or indicators of success for the game project, such as positive player feedback, high download numbers, or industry recognition.
- Demonstrate your passion for game development by discussing how the project aligns with your interests and how it has contributed to your growth as a game developer.
